Dropbox Faces Flurry of Data Breach Lawsuits Over Alleged Security Failures in California

Dropbox is facing a surge of data breach class actions in California, with complaints filed in May in the Northern District of California. The lawsuits accuse the file-sharing platform of exposing its clients to a “high risk of identity theft or fraud” following a cyberattack on April 24. Plaintiffs argue that Dropbox failed to implement adequate security measures to prevent the breach by an “undoubtedly nefarious” third party. More details are available here.
